Why established trails matter—beyond nostalgia

It’s easy to dismiss an old faint track as obsolete, but legacy trails perform multiple roles that new, engineered routes rarely replace overnight.

1. Cultural memory and stewardship

Old routes connect generations of users, local guides, and traditional land managers. They embed knowledge about water sources, seasonal hazards, and wayfinding that isn’t always obvious from a new, sanitized map. When a trail is removed from park maps without documentation, that human knowledge is at risk of vanishing.

2. Redundancy and safety

Multiple routes to the same destination create redundancy. If a new bridge fails or a wildfire closes a corridor, a legacy route can provide an alternative exit or emergency access. For backcountry routes especially, preserving alternate tracks is often a life-saver.

3. Biodiversity and microhabitats

Some older trails skirt unique microhabitats because they followed ridgelines, animal game paths, or cultural contours. Thoughtful preservation planning can protect these ecological linkages while managing visitor impact.

4. Low-cost access and local economies

Unpaved, legacy routes often support local guiding businesses, small trailhead economies, and dispersed recreation that big developments don’t serve well. Keeping them functional maintains diverse access points for varied budgets and skill levels.

Late 2025 and early 2026 accelerated several trends that affect trail preservation. Park managers who understand these shifts can choose strategies that protect legacy routes while embracing innovation.

High-resolution mapping and LiDAR + AR-driven visitor tools

More agencies now use LiDAR and high-resolution satellite imagery to produce detailed terrain models. Augmented-reality (AR) wayfinding tools are being integrated into park apps. These technologies improve safety but can unintentionally prioritize routes that are easiest to render over routes that are historically important.

Data-driven reroutes due to climate and infrastructure

Climate-driven erosion, floodplain shifts, and increased multi-use trail demand are forcing reroutes in many parks. By 2026, adaptive trail planning—rerouting to reduce maintenance—has become common. Without a preservation-first protocol, some classic tracks are being removed instead of conserved.

Citizen-sourced mapping and crowd data

Platforms like OpenStreetMap, trail apps, and social GPS datasets (e.g., Strava heatmaps) now influence official maps. This democratization helps flag heavily used legacy routes, but it can also expose sensitive areas if not managed responsibly.

How travelers can experience legacy routes safely and responsibly

If you want to walk a classic corridor—whether a faint spur to a viewpoint or a backcountry route—do so in a way that respects conservation, safety, and park policy.

Pre-trip research checklist

  • Contact the park office or ranger station. Ask about undocumented or decommissioned routes and hazards.
  • Use multiple sources: recent topographic maps, archived park maps, OpenStreetMap traces, and community GPS tracks.
  • Download offline maps and save GPS waypoints. Keep a paper map and compass as redundancy.

On-trail safety essentials

  1. Leave your plan with someone and set check-in times.
  2. Carry navigation tools and know how to use them—don’t rely solely on AR apps that require a signal.
  3. Pack for changing conditions: extra water, layers, headlamp, and a basic first-aid kit.
  4. Respect seasonal closures—some legacy routes are closed to protect wildlife breeding or fragile vegetation.

Low-impact navigation

When following a faint track, stick to the existing tread. Do not cut switchbacks or create parallel scrapes. If you find the official route has changed and the legacy track is still passable, document GPS coordinates and report them constructively to the park.

Practical steps park managers can take to balance development with preservation

Managers often face competing priorities: safety, accessibility, maintenance budgets, and conservation. The key is a documented decision pathway that treats legacy routes as assets—not liabilities.

A preservation-first mapping protocol

Before altering a printed map or app layer, implement a protocol that requires the following steps:

  1. Field verification and ecological assessment of the legacy route.
  2. Document GPS tracks, historical use, and cultural context.
  3. Public notice and a 60–90 day comment period for stakeholders and local user groups.
  4. Trial reroute with signage and monitoring before permanently decommissioning any corridor.

Archive and interpret

Create a Legacy Routes Archive—a digital repository with GPS tracks, historical maps, photographs, and oral histories. Publish an interpretive layer in park apps that marks historic alignments as "legacy" rather than removing them entirely.

Adaptive maintenance and phased decommissioning

If a route must be closed for ecological reasons, adopt a phased approach: stabilize user behavior, install clear signage explaining the closure, and monitor recovery. If closure is permanent, consider restoring the corridor gradually and documenting recovery outcomes.

Funding and community partnerships

Maintenance budgets are tight, so build partnerships:

  • Volunteer "Adopt-a-Route" programs with tool caches and training.
  • Small grants and micro-donations targeted to legacy trail upkeep.
  • Joint projects with local universities for LiDAR or eDNA surveys that justify preservation to funders.

Use technology—but with safeguards

Deploy trail counters, remote cameras, and GPS collar data to understand usage without exposing sensitive locations publicly. When sharing legacy tracks on public platforms, generalize or obfuscate coordinates for vulnerable areas.

How communities and hikers can advocate for old routes

Advocacy is most effective when it combines data, respectful engagement, and practical support. Here’s a playbook you can use.

Collect and present useful evidence

  • Compile recent GPS tracks, visitor counts, and photos showing the route’s condition and uses.
  • Document seasonal values—water sources, wildlife corridors, or cultural sites tied to the route.
  • Survey local guiding businesses and outdoor groups to quantify economic and social value.

Engage constructively with managers

Park staff respond to organized, solution-oriented input. Offer to pilot a maintenance plan, fund a sign, or host a community workday. Show willingness to help monitor ecological impacts.

Campaign tactics that work

  1. Create a petition with clear, specific asks—e.g., “Document GPS track and fund one maintenance season.”
  2. Propose a compromise: temporary closure with monitoring instead of immediate decommissioning.
  3. Run a “legacy routes mapping” volunteer event to help create the archive managers need.

Safety and conservation best practices—what both sides should commit to

Whatever decisions are made, commit to shared safety and preservation principles.

  • Transparent mapping: Mark legacy alignments in apps as legacy, closed, or active—never just delete without record.
  • Responsible disclosure: Limit public coordinates for ecologically sensitive routes.
  • Educate visitors: Use trailhead signage and digital briefs to explain why some routes are preserved and why some are closed.
  • Monitor outcomes: Use simple metrics—erosion rates, vegetation recovery, and incident reports—to evaluate the effects of changes.
